Overview of the 1995 CHEVROLET VAN

The 1995 CHEVROLET VAN has received a total of 31 safety complaints filed with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). The most commonly reported problems involve the Service Brakes Hydraulicantilocktraction Controlelectronic Limited Slip (4 complaints), Air Bagsfrontal (3 complaints), and Engine And Engine Coolingenginegasoline (3 complaints).

#10189895 | 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ING | | N/A miles
RIDING DOWN THE ROAD, STOPPING AT A STOP LIGHT/STOP SIGN, AND TAKING OFF FROM SIGN/LIGHT. ACTS LIKE IT'S GOING TO CUT OFF AND SOMETIMES DOES. WHEN I TAKE OFF, I'M NOT SURE WHETHER IT'S GOING TO GO OR CUT OFF (SORTA LIKE YOU MAYBE GETTING READY TO RUN OUT OF GAS)CLOSE TO SEVERAL ACCIDENTS. IF THIS VEHICLE CUTS OFF IN THE MIDDLE OF CROSSING ROADS/4 LANES, THIS COULD BE FATAL. IT'S LIKE THIS PROBLEM COMES AND GOES, YOU NEVER KNOW. SOUNDS AND ACTS LIKE SOMETHING IS CLOGGED UP OR STICKS CAUSING LOSS OF ENGINE VACCUM. NOTHING HAS BEEN DONE ABOUT THIS AND I CAN'T AFFORD TO GET IT LOOKED AT ANYTIME SOON. ALSO, SCARED TO GO OUT AT NIGHT WITH NOT KNOWING WHAT COULD HAPPEN. *TR

#745244 | SUSPENSION:FRONT:SHOCK ABSORBER | | N/A miles
THE SHOCK ABSORBER BRACKET BROKE OFF ON FRONT RIGHT FRAME DUE TO RUST AND THIN METAL DEALER WILL LOOK AT IT BUT DOES NOT KNOW IF HE CAN FIX IT TO ME THIS IS A BAD ENGINEERING JOB ON GMS PART THANK YOU. *AK
